The Most Popular Air Transportation Associate Degree Schools in Kansas ranking is one of many tools that Course Advisor has developed to help you make your educational decision. Our analysis looked at 5 schools in Kansas to see which associate degree programs were the most popular for students. To create this ranking we looked at how many students graduated from the Air Transportation program at each school on the list.
